更改我的 Cordova iOS 应用程序版本
Posted
技术标签:
【中文标题】更改我的 Cordova iOS 应用程序版本【英文标题】:Change my version for an Cordova iOS App 【发布时间】:2015-05-27 10:22:31 【问题描述】:我有一个应用程序在管理器屏幕中显示为 0.0.1 版,但现有应用程序在 App Store 中是 1.0 版 - 我基本上想将此版本号设置为 1.1(因此它不同于任何其他应用程序)版本并且不会覆盖)
我在 Xcode 中的哪里或直接在代码本身中更改它?
【问题讨论】:
【参考方案1】:这是从config.xml
(项目根文件夹中的那个)中widget
元素的version
属性派生的。
您必须在更改 config.xml
后运行 cordova prepare ios
才能更新项目。
(您可以直接在 Xcode 中更改它 - 有一个以 -Info.plist
结尾的文件,但每次生成项目时都会覆盖此更改。)
【讨论】:
提醒,运行cordova prepare ios时要小心,它会将根www文件复制到platform/ios。直接在 xcode 中工作的人在运行此命令时经常会丢失所有工作! 奇怪的是,它是如何使用您在 config.xml 中提供的版本 attr 来更新 Xcode 中的Version
和 Build
的。 Build
通常不是语义版本字符串。以上是关于更改我的 Cordova iOS 应用程序版本的主要内容,如果未能解决你的问题,请参考以下文章
Cordova/Phonegap iOS - 应用程序发送到后台后更改了 html5 输入文本类型
如何在 iOS 中更改 cordova-camera-plugin 语言?